收藏 / 列表

逐夢AI - 基於YOLOv8的牛行為檢測識別項目|完整源碼數據集+PyQt5界面+完整訓練流程+開箱即用!

基於YOLOv8的牛行為檢測識別項目|完整源碼數據集+PyQt5界面+完整訓練流程+開箱即用! 源碼包含:完整YOLOv8訓練代碼+數據集(帶標註)+權重文件+直接可允許檢測的yolo檢測程序+直接部署教程/訓練教程 源碼在文末嗶哩嗶哩視頻簡介處獲取。 本系統通過 PyQt5 圖形界面 提供多種輸入方式,包括: 圖片識別:單張或批量圖片檢測牛的行為狀態。 文件夾識別:批量處理指定文件夾內的圖

機器學習 , 人工智能 , 深度學習

艾體寶IT - 艾體寶乾貨 | Redis Python 開發系列#2 核心數據結構(上)

前言 繼上篇文章,成功連接 Redis 之後,我們直面其核心:數據結構。Redis 的強大,絕非僅是簡單的鍵值存儲,而是其精心設計的多種數據結構所能解決的各種業務場景。 本篇讀者收益 精通 String 類型的全部核心命令,掌握其在緩存、計數器、分佈式鎖中的應用。 精通 Hash 類型的全部核心命令,掌握其高效存儲對象、進行分組統計的技巧。 深刻理解 String 和 Hash 的底層差異

後端

張老師講數字孿生 - 數字孿生AI 3D引擎賦能十五五數字化轉型

2024年,《數字中國建設整體佈局規劃》明確提出要"構建數字孿生空間",國家發改委等多部門聯合印發《關於推進數字孿生流域建設的指導意見》,數字孿生技術正式納入"十五五"國家信息化規劃重點發展方向。 隨着數字化轉型深入推進,數字孿生作為連接物理世界與數字世界的核心技術,正成為各行業智能化升級的關鍵支撐。數字孿生AI 3D引擎通過構建高精度、實時交互的虛擬映射,為"十五五"期間數字孿生技術的規模化應用

數字化轉型 , 資訊 , 人工智能 , 後端 , 前端

數據集成與治理 - 數據字典是什麼?和數據庫、數據倉庫有什麼關係?

公眾號不引流 工作中處理數據時,你是否曾被這些問題所困擾: 數據庫裏的字段名到底是什麼意思?報表裏的指標是怎麼算出來的?某個數據是從哪裏來的? 數據字典就是專門解答這些問題的工具。 它​詳細記錄了數據的名稱、具體含義、類型、長度、可能的取值範圍、從哪裏來、怎麼算的等關鍵信息​。無論是寫代碼的開發者、用數據做分析的同事,還是管理數據的人員,都需要數據字典來準確理解和使用數據。今天這篇文章會直接告訴你

數據結構 , 數據庫

大廠碼農老A - CR被批“寫得像坨屎”,我三句話讓他當場閉嘴

這坨屎山,我接了 大家好,我是老A。 我想很多程序員有過這種經歷,新接手一個項目,打開工程一看,妥妥的一大坨🤦,內心OS:好嘛,又要“屎山雕花”了。。。 我這兩年在做電商業務,所以業務上經常會搞大促,3天一小促,5天一大促,作為技術早就習慣了這種研發節奏(倒排)。今年6月是我們業務年中的一次大型大促,所以5月份的需求爆炸多,基本都是倒排,業務天天拿着大喇叭在我們屁股後喊📢:這個需求不做就

segmentfault , springboot , JAVA , 程序員 , 後端

沉浸式趣談 - VS Code 代碼片段指南: 從基礎到高級技巧

今天咱們來聊聊 VS Code 裏的自定義代碼片段。 這玩意兒簡直是提升編碼效率的神器, 用好了能讓你敲代碼更方便! 不管你是剛入行的菜鳥還是身經百戰的老兵,這篇攻略都能讓你在代碼片段的世界裏玩得飛起。 繫好安全帶,我們開始起飛啦! 代碼片段是啥玩意兒? 簡單説, 代碼片段就是一些預先定義好的代碼模板。你只需要敲幾個字母,噌的一下,一大段代碼就蹦出來了。 比如説, 你可以把一個常用的函數結構設置成

code , visual-studio-code , 開發 , 代碼片段

vivo互聯網技術 - 如何“拼”出一個頁面-遊戲中心模塊化實踐

一、背景 vivo遊戲中心是一款垂類的應用商店,為用户提供了多元化遊戲的下載渠道。隨着遊戲中心手遊品類的豐富,各品類用户的量級也不斷增加,不同遊戲偏好的用户核心關注點也不同,從預約、測試、首發、更新到維護,不同遊戲生命週期節點的運營需要突出的重點不同。 針對上述不同業務場景,運營人員為了服務好廣大的vivo遊戲用户,需要進行精細化運營,以不同的視覺樣式呈現給不同用户。比如,針對獨立遊戲品類的用户,

開發 , 組件化 , 模塊化開發

float64 - ByteByteGo學習筆記:一致性哈希

一、引言 在分佈式系統中,實現水平擴展的關鍵在於能夠有效地分配請求並均勻地將數據分配到各個服務器上。一致性哈希算法作為一種常用的技術,能夠很好地解決這一問題。本文將深入探討一致性哈希算法的原理、實現以及應用場景。 二、重哈希問題 2.1 傳統哈希方法 傳統的哈希方法通常使用取模運算來確定鍵存儲在哪個服務器上,即 serverIndex = hash(key) % N,其中 N 是服務器池的大小。這

數據結構 , 系統架構 , 一致性哈希算法 , 後端

universe_king - 使用pydantic 處理各種各樣亂七八糟的時間格式字符串,尤其是 iso8601

這個教程是叫你怎麼優雅的處理各種亂七八糟的日期字符串 按照 iso8601,下面的格式都是合法的 2023-08-15T12:34:56Z 2023-08-15 12:34:56+00:00 2023-08-15 12:34:56 如果你要自己寫 re 去處理這種 T、+ 、Z 這些區別,就會很麻煩很麻煩 怎麼優雅的處理?用 pydantic 就行,pydantic 已經把這種亂七八糟的

Python

bin的技術小屋 - 時間輪在 Netty , Kafka 中的設計與實現

本文基於 Netty 4.1.112.Final , Kafka 3.9.0 版本進行討論 在業務開發的場景中,我們經常會遇到很多定時任務的需求。比如,生成業務報表,週期性對賬,同步數據,訂單支付超時處理等。針對業務場景中定時任務邏輯複雜,執行時間長的特點,市面上已經有很多成熟的任務調度中間件可供我們選擇。比如:ElasticJob , XXL-JOB , PowerJob 等等。 而在中間件的場

netty , JAVA , kafka

山頭人漢波 - 前端學Ruby:前言

人與人的區別不是”受過教育“和”沒受過教育“,而是”喜歡閲讀“和”不喜歡閲讀“ ——《納瓦爾寶典》 寫在前面,筆者是一名前端,現在來學習 ruby,打算寫一系列的文章,將自己學習 ruby on rails 的經驗分享出來,於是就有了這一系列文章:「前端學Ruby:七天筆記」 第一天 安裝 Ruby、Rails 第二天 熟悉 Ruby 語法 第三天 熟悉 Rails 第四天 唐詩API 項目 第五

ruby-on-rails , ruby , rubygems , 前端

god23bin - 在 IDEA 中創建 Java Web 項目的方式(詳細步驟教程)

開發環境 以下是我的開發環境 JDK 1.8 Maven 3.6.3 Tomcat 9.0 IDEA 2019(2019 無所畏懼,即使現在已經 2023 年了哈哈哈) 最原始的 Java Web 項目 下面的內容可能會因 IDEA 版本不同,而有些選項不同,但是大同小異。 1. 打開 IDEA 點擊 Create New Project 2. 點擊 Java Enterprise

java-ee , 教程 , intellij-idea , JAVA , java-web

codists - RabbitMQ的Overview Totals是空

一、問題描述 RabbitMQ 版本:4.0.2,Erlang 版本:26.2.5.4。 RabbitMQ 頁面管理(rabbitmq_management)的 Overview Totals 是空: 二、原因分析 RabbitMQ 的配置: management_agent.disable_metrics_collector = true 導致。將 management_agent.disa

rabbitmq , go

弗拉德 - 【Python 1-16】Python手把手教程之——類Class的繼承、父類、子類

作者 | 弗拉德 來源 | 弗拉德(公眾號:fulade_me) 繼承 編寫類時,並非總是要從空白開始。如果你要編寫的類是另一個現成類的特殊版本,可使用 繼承。一個類繼承另一個類時,它將自動獲得另一個類的所有屬性和方法;原有的類稱為父類, 而新類稱為子類。子類繼承了其父類的所有屬性和方法,同時還可以定義自己的屬性和方法。 子類的方法__init__() 創建子類的實例時,Python首先需要

python3 , python2.7 , 人工智能 , 深度學習 , Python

Rick Carter - 修復達夢EFCore驅動布爾類型兼容問題

dm庫相比其他庫本身缺少一些語法差異,也可以説是缺陷。 比如: 0和1無法直接在sql中當作真假值用,where 0這種寫法不支持,報錯:查詢使用值表達式作為過濾條件; t.field is null 也無法直接作為select項; 不支持OUTER APPLY等SQL語法; 以及數據庫函數中的又只能用0和1作為布爾參數值。 但是dm.efcore生成的語句就是這樣的

.net , 後端

XHunter - Golang筆記之Redis

本文首發於公眾號:Hunter後端 原文鏈接:Golang筆記之Redis 這一篇筆記主要介紹 Golang 連接和使用 Redis,以下是本篇筆記目錄: 目錄 1、安裝模塊 2、連接 Redis 3、字符串 1. 字符串寫入 2. 字符串讀取 4、哈希 1. 寫入 1) 單字段寫入

go , 後端

好想成為人類啊 - C語言中的算術類型轉換

1.尋常算數轉換 在C語言中,當不同類型的操作數參與到算術運算時,編譯器會將操作數轉換成同一類型,再運算。這一過程被稱為尋常算術轉換,由於這個過程我們程序員看不見,所以它也是一種隱式類型轉換(見整型提升) 1.1尋常算數轉換的過程 1.1.1整型提升 若操作數是小整數類型(字節大小小於int),會自動進行整型提升,提升為int或unsigned int(見整型提升) 1.1.2類型提升 和整型提升

後端

俞凡 - 10 分鐘搞定神經網絡

本文簡單介紹了神經網絡的基本原理、組成和基礎算法,並通過示例介紹了最簡單的神經網絡是如何工作的。原文:Learn How Neural Networks Work 神經網絡是人工智能中最重要的組成部分之一,若沒有神經網絡,像 ChatGPT 這樣的大語言模型就不會存在。實際上,幾乎所有深度學習模型都在某種程度上使用了神經網絡。 這就是為什麼瞭解神經網絡的工作原理如此重要。所以,讓我們重温一

人工智能

點量實時雲渲染 - 破解數字孿生落地難題,點量雲流引領高效新徑

在數字化轉型的浪潮的正盛的當下,數字孿生作為連接物理世界與數字世界的核心橋樑,正深刻變革着城市規劃、工業製造、科研教育等領域。然而,構建一個高保真、高實時、高可用的數字孿生系統,始終面臨着一系列技術挑戰:海量三維模型與實時渲染數據的輕量化交付、多終端設備的廣泛適配、以及至關重要的數據安全與國產化信創需求。 點量雲流實時雲渲染以五大核心技術標杆,為這些挑戰提供了完美的解決方案,並已在實際項目中獲得驗

資訊 , 服務器 , 前端

新程快咖員 - IDEA插件Maven開發版本管理小助手Maven With Me更新2.5.x版本啦~

IDEA插件Maven開發版本管理小助手Maven With Me更新2.5.x版本啦~ ‌🏷️ 標籤‌:#maven #idea插件 #java #nexus #mpvp #MavenWithMe #MavenSearch #MavenUpdate 前言 工欲善其事必先利其器! 輕便快捷是初心,勢必為節省您的大量時間和心力而前行!讓更多的時間和價值留在更重要的地方!!! 希望它能成為一款真正有

maven , intellij-idea , springboot , JAVA , 後端

程序員小富 - 上線別再“一刀切”!Gateway 做流量染色 + 灰度發佈,告別線上事故

大家好,我是小富~ 最近團隊迭代頻繁,連續幾周都在做新功能上線,從測試環境驗證到生產環境放量,全程謹小慎微沒出一次故障,主要是用好了 Spring Cloud Gateway 的 流量染色 和 灰度發佈。 很多同學面試時被問用過 SpringCloud Gateway 嗎?,只會説做限流、鑑權,但這些都是網關的基礎操作。要想出去吹,得説用網關解決線上新版本平穩上線的問題。比如今天要分享的流量染色

springboot , JAVA

duokeli - 三角洲行動代練代打護航小程序:它為什麼能成為靠譜又好用的接單軟件!

代練代打説白了就是“DiDi出行”,流程也簡單就是客户發單,代練接單,平台裁定,交易清晰明瞭。平台化運作徹底杜絕了“老闆跑單”或者“代練跑路”的信任危機的出現。老闆安心發單,代練者放心接單,平台則擔當公正裁判,交易全程透明可追溯。 一、代練陪練系統V3.0版本: 系統基於Uniapp+TP6框架開發,客户移動端採用uniapp開發,後台管理採用TP6開發。 系統支持微信公眾號、微信小程序、

二次開發 , 小程序 , 前端框架 , 源碼 , 後台搭建

牛肉燒烤屋 - 詳解分佈式緩存不一致性的所有情況!除了分佈式緩存外,其它場景又是如何解決緩存一致性的呢?

[toc] 引言 持久化層和緩存層的一致性問題也通常被稱為「雙寫一致性問題」,“雙寫”意為數據既在數據庫中保存一份,也在緩存中保存一份。對於一致性來説,包含強一致性和弱一致性,強一致性保證寫入後立即可以讀取,弱一致性則不保證立即可以讀取寫入後的值,而是儘可能的保證在經過一定時間後可以讀取到,在弱一致性中應用最為廣泛的模型則是最終一致性模型,即保證在一定時間之後寫入和讀取達到一致的狀態。 我們一般會

redis , 緩存 , JAVA , 一致性

大衞talk - Chrome Devtools調試技巧

由於圖片和格式解析問題,可前往 閲讀原文 Chrome DevTools 是開發者用於調試 Web 應用程序、分析性能、檢查元素和網絡請求的重要工具。無論是前端開發人員還是後端工程師,熟練掌握 Chrome DevTools 都能顯著提高開發效率和調試精度。通過 DevTools,我們可以快速識別並解決性能瓶頸、修復 bug、優化用户體驗 Chrome DevTools 提供了多種強大的功能,包括

debugging , chrome-devtools , 優化 , 前端